Handover: Thistledown zero-downtime migrations. Pattern is expand/contract — add nullable column, dual-write behind the `mig_dualwrite` flag, backfill in 10k-row batches, then drop old column in a later release. Never combine backfill and schema change in one deploy. Reviewer: check batch sizes and lock timeouts on every migration PR. Migration ownership sits with the person named below.

named custodian: Oliath Ralax

It is now split into `QG_BREAKER_MAX_FAILURES` (integer) and `QG_BREAKER_WINDOW_SECS` (seconds). Migration: remove the old key everywhere, set both new keys explicitly, and note that defaults changed from 5/30 to 10/60. Because the breaker's half-open probe now authenticates against the upstream health endpoint, the env file must also define the probe credential immediately after the two breaker settings, on the following line.

sealed setting: RELAY_SECRET5=82864

## Environment variables: Brimstack Admin dark mode

Dark-mode support in the Brimstack admin dashboard is gated by THEME_DARK_ENABLED and rolled out per tenant via the Lanternset flag service. Release managers should flip the flag only after the CSS bundle version check passes. Fetching tenant flag state requires the Lanternset access token, which the env file sets on the following line.

vault entry, yahif-yajep: COURIER_KEY29=b802bdf8034096b65a51c6ba5abe2

Step 7 — load test the checkout flow. Before you approve this PR, spin up Swarmlet against the Pinefold staging checkout and push 500 virtual shoppers for ten minutes. Watch the cart-to-payment handoff; that's where the old code fell over. If p95 stays under 800ms, we're good. Swarmlet writes its run results straight into the perf-history database, so it needs write access there, and it reads the target from the connection line that follows.

replica DSN, tawef-hahap: mysql://eliix_svc:FiIC0jz@db-394a.lumiclabs.internal:5432/holius

## Break-Glass Access: Replica Lag Alarm

If the Quillstone read-replica lag alarm fires and the on-call lead is unreachable, contractors may use break-glass access to restart replication on the standby. Log the action in the Opsbook channel afterward. To unlock the break-glass console, enter the recovery passphrase below.

vault phrase of bagaf-kajeg = jorath-feniel-briir-siliel-ralix